Shaba National Reserve
National Park Wildlife reserve in northern Kenya, diverse savannah habitats
A dry savanna reserve along the Ewaso Ng’iro, known for elephants, Grevy’s zebra and reticulated giraffe. Tourists come for game drives, riverine habitats and remote, less-crowded safaris often combined with nearby Samburu reserves.
Shaba National Reserve is a protected wildlife reserve in Isiolo County, Kenya, located at latitude 0.65000, longitude 37.83333. It forms part of a cluster of conservation areas in central-northern Kenya and is identified on national park and reserve maps.
The reserve comprises arid to semi-arid habitats along riverine corridors and open plains that support large mammals adapted to the environment. Game drives and wildlife viewing are the primary visitor activities, typically arranged from nearby towns and lodges.
Shaba was established as a protected area to conserve regional wildlife populations and habitats; it is managed under Kenyan conservation authorities and associated local organisations. Management focuses on habitat protection, anti-poaching and regulated tourism.
Geographically the reserve lies in central-northern Kenya, with the Ewaso Ng’iro River an important landscape feature; access is typically from Isiolo and nearby towns that serve as gateways for visitors.
- Landscape and neighbours: Sits along the Ewaso Ng'iro River and adjoins or lies close to the Samburu and Buffalo Springs protected areas in central-northern Kenya.
- Wildlife and management: The reserve is managed for wildlife conservation and tourism, with species commonly recorded in the area including elephant and several arid-adapted ungulates.
How to Get to Shaba National Reserve #
Isiolo town is the nearest hub-regular buses and minibuses connect from Nairobi (about 5-7 hours by road). From Isiolo, arrange a 4x4 or licensed guide to access Shaba Reserve; roads into the reserve are rough and weather-dependent. Scheduled flights to Isiolo Airport are limited; private charter may be required for time-sensitive travel.
Tips for Visiting Shaba National Reserve #
- Visit with an organized, locally-licensed guide-this is ranger-patrolled land with specific access rules and practical safety concerns.
- Plan arrivals for the cooler hours (early morning and late afternoon) when wildlife, especially elephant and rare antelopes, is most active.
- Bring serious insect protection and long-sleeved clothing-the semi-arid lowlands can be mosquito-heavy at dusk.
Best Time to Visit Shaba National Reserve #
Dry season (June-September) is the most practical for game viewing and access; avoid the wettest months unless prepared for rough tracks.
Weather & Climate near Shaba National Reserve #
Shaba National Reserve's climate is classified as Tropical Savanna - Tropical Savanna climate with consistently warm temperatures year-round. Temperatures range from 17°C to 32°C. Semi-arid with limited rainfall with a pronounced dry season.
